About Chilhowie, VA And It’s Education Institutions
Chilhowie, Virginia, a small town situated in Smyth County, is a community rich in history and hometown charm. Founded in 1913, this picturesque town derives its name from the Cherokee word “Chilhowee,” which means “valley of many deer,” reflecting the area's abundant natural beauty. Notable landmarks that capture the essence of Chilhowie's heritage include the historical Chilhowie Community Apple Festival, which celebrates the town’s agricultural roots, and the Chilhowie Historic District showcasing various architectural styles that span over a century. With a population that hovers around 1,700 residents, it's a tight-knit community that values its landmarks and proud history.
The Chilhowie education system is supported by the Smyth County School District, which oversees the public education for the town's children. The top-ranked public K-12 institutions include Chilhowie Elementary School, Chilhowie Middle School, and Chilhowie High School, all known for fostering an environment conducive to academic and personal growth. Although Chilhowie does not host its own university, the town's educational needs for higher education can be fulfilled by the nearby institutions like Emory and Henry College, located approximately 20 miles away. Additionally, educational resources are made available to local students through public services such as the Chilhowie Public Library, which provides access to a wealth of knowledge and learning programs.

About AP Physics & AP Physics Tutoring
AP Physics: Fostering a Deeper Understanding of the Physical World
Advanced Placement (AP) Physics refers to college-level physics courses and exams offered by high schools in partnership with the College Board in the United States and Canada. Designed to simulate a college physics program, AP Physics seeks to provide high school students with a foundation in the principles and applications of physics before they embark on higher education. By taking this course, students can earn college credits, skip introductory courses in college, or fulfill general education requirements, depending on the policies of the institution they attend.
There are multiple types of AP Physics courses available, each exploring different areas of physics. AP Physics 1 covers classical mechanics, waves, and basic electrical circuits, and is algebra-based, making it more accessible to students without a strong mathematics background. AP Physics 2 continues with fluid mechanics, thermodynamics, electricity and magnetism, optics, and topics in modern physics. Like AP Physics 1, it is also algebra-based. On the more rigorous side, AP Physics C is divided into two parts: Mechanics and Electricity and Magnetism. These courses are calculus-based and require students to apply differential and integral calculus in their solutions to physics problems.
Entities related to AP Physics include the College Board, which administers the AP program, as well as high schools that provide these courses, and colleges that recognize the AP credits. Standardized testing organizations and educational material publishers are also involved by providing resources such as practice tests and study aids for students.
Tutoring someone struggling with AP Physics involves a strategy that enhances conceptual understanding while developing problem-solving skills. Effective tutoring means first ensuring a foundational grasp of algebra and trigonometry, which are critical for solving physics problems. Tutors should encourage active learning through questioning and allow students to work through problems independently before giving a detailed explanation. Interactive demonstrations, using both real-world experiments and computer simulations, can be particularly helpful in illustrating abstract concepts. Moreover, relating physics concepts to everyday experiences can make the material more tangible. Consistent practice and review sessions aimed at both conceptual questions and complex numerical problems prepare the student for the format and rigor of the AP exams. Peer study groups and online resources can also provide additional support.
The most common concepts in AP Physics revolve around Newton's laws of motion, energy conservation, momentum, wave behavior, and basic electrical circuits. Students often find topics such as rotational motion, electromagnetism, and fluids more challenging due to the complexity and abstract nature of the concepts, as well as the integration of more advanced mathematics. The difficulty of these concepts can be mitigated by a structured approach to the course that breaks down each topic into small, manageable pieces, reinforcing them through both practice and contextual understanding.
Overall, success in AP Physics isn't solely about mastering the content; it's also about developing critical thinking and applying mathematical concepts. A holistic tutoring approach that emphasizes both theory and practical problem-solving can help students succeed not only in their AP exams but in future scientific endeavors.
